Ecoren Energy has given an order to Vestas for wind turbines for the 20MW Mullur Wind Farm to be built in the Indian state of Karnataka.

The order includes supply and installation of nine V110-2.0 MW turbines delivered in 2.2 MW Power Optimised Mode, a 10-year full scope AOM 5000 service contract as well as a VestasOnline Business SCADA system for data-driven monitoring and preventive maintenance. Turbine delivery has started and commissioning is expected by the fourth quarter of 2018.

Vestas Asia Pacific president Clive Turton said: “With the second order from Ecoren Energy this year, we underline how our reliable and versatile technology delivers the most effective solutions and lowest cost of energy for our customers in India. The Indian wind energy market is growing tremendously and with this order, Vestas will further enhance the economic growth of the country by providing job opportunities in both manufacturing and operations.”

Ecoren Energy chairman and managing director Prasad Yerneni said: “At Ecoren, we always believe in having the best global technology partnerships to harness our resource-rich sites and our collaboration with Vestas on both projects is an important milestone in our high value growth journey here.”

Once completed, the project will have an estimated annual production of 61 GWh.
